Output 6ec614743db08cfdaceb590d8ba826494e9e20385abaee0036a15442f3e923a3:0

value
1390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ac1a944da618bc19bc134c69d3674b0ca450814 OP_EQUAL
address
3P6J3FNceLMQUHpjUqRg8bZVymug1DJEZv
transaction
6ec614743db08cfdaceb590d8ba826494e9e20385abaee0036a15442f3e923a3
confirmations
378821
spent
true